Removing Odors from Glass Jars?

January 28, 2005

Removing Odors from Glass JarsI'm making some jam and marmalade at the moment and have had some people save their old jars for me, but some of them have had pickled onions in them and i just can't get rid of the smell! Does anyone have any tips for me? I will be very grateful.

Try scrubbing them out with a paste of baking soda.

Fill with 1/4 white vinegar and 3/4 cold water. Let soak for a few hours or overnight if possible. This works for odors in plastic containers-maybe it will work for glass too! Good Luck!
